Gomoku (Five in a Row) might be the world's most accessible yet addictive strategy game — two players take turns placing stones, and the first to line up five wins. The rules take 30 seconds to learn, but the strategic depth is far greater than it appears: opening patterns, the interplay of open threes and closed fours, and the delicate balance of attack and defense create endlessly engaging gameplay.

A training ground for strategy: Opening patterns matter enormously in Gomoku — Kagetsu, Pugetsu, Kansei and other classic openings each have distinct advantages.
